A Texas-Sized Punch


With his championship fight coming up November 13 vs Antonio Margarito at Dallas Stadium, Nike released this week a set of Trainers 1.2s: a white/gold mid PE...


...and a lovely pair of low PEs, the first to be released of the 1.2s.


The lows feature black perforated nubuck on the toe, mixed with granulated black leather, orange Flywire thread, and black Kevlar-like heel tab.




The “MP” logo on the heel and translucent sole just sets these off.

CMFTs of Home


To rival the Nike Trainer 1.2 "All For One" event tonight, Brand Jordan will drop the CMFT 11 SC Premier tomorrow at the Nike Santa Monica and Nike Roosevelt Field shops.


The limited hybrid release differs from the white/red & white/blue CMFT 11 releases, as if features a carbon fiber mudguard to celebrate the CF plate on the AJ 11 Concord, an iconic Tinker Hatfield invention.

A Knockout


This Pac-Man print along with these 1.2 Trainers...


...are just one of ten "All For One" framed art/shoe sets available at Niketown New York tomorrow night.

The athletes featured are Bo Jackson, Bryan Clay, Larry Fitzgerald, Adrian Peterson, Troy Polamalu, Albert Pujols, Cristiano Ronaldo, Brandon Roy, Amare Stoudamire and Manny Pacquiao.

Packs will cost $350 and only 12 prints of each athlete poster were made. A first-come, first-serve raffle will determine opportunities to purchase a pack.

V-Day


Looks like the Lebron signature series will be re-tooled yet again....


Thanks to my boy Ming at Marqueesole, we get a glimpse of the Lebron 8 V2. It's a more lightweight version of the first version we have already seen.


The midsole and outsoles are nearly identical, but the upper is different. It features a lightweight translucent shell as well as a heat-bonded toe-cap for added durability.


So as the Lebron 6 made way for the Soldier 3 and the Lebron 7 stepped aside for the Lebron 7 P.S., there looks to be three versions of the Lebron 8: V1, V2 and V3.

"Meshing" With A Good Thing?


The Nike Air Jordan XIII "Altitude" release is slated for either November or December, but some recently posted images of the Retro from Osneaker shows one alarming change -- a mesh upper....


Following in the footsteps of the Flint XIII retro, the 2010 Altitude will have a mesh upper instead of the full-grain leather upper...
